MAX221
+5V, 1µA, Single RS-232 Transceiver with AutoShutdown
General Description
The MAX221 is a +5V-powered, single transmit/receive RS-232 and V.28 communications interface with automatic shutdown/wake-up features and high data rate capabilities.
The MAX221 achieves a low 1µA supply current with Maxim’s revolutionary AutoShutdown™ feature. AutoShutdown saves power without changes to the existing BIOS or operating system by entering lowpower shutdown mode when the RS-232 cable is disconnected, or when the transmitter of the connected peripheral is off. The MAX221 wakes up and drives the INVALID pin high when an active RS-232 cable is connected, signaling the host that a peripheral is connected to the communications port.
